The Certificate in Academic Honesty and Strategies For Avoiding Plagiarism is a valuable course that equips students with the knowledge and skills necessary to maintain academic integrity and avoid plagiarism.
By completing this certificate program, learners will gain a deep understanding of the importance of academic honesty and the strategies for avoiding plagiarism, including proper citation and referencing techniques.
The program covers a range of topics, including the definition and consequences of plagiarism, the differences between plagiarism and academic dishonesty, and the role of technology in facilitating academic integrity.
Upon completion of the program, learners will be able to identify and avoid plagiarism, develop effective citation and referencing skills, and maintain academic integrity in their academic work.
